Possible Causes
- Swelling Of The Gums
- Description: The gums may become inflamed and swell, and that may cause the ledge that looks like a piece of meat.
- Why: Gum diseases such as gingivitis or Periodontitis.
- Tooth Abscess
- Description: A tooth root abscess formation, may cause a bulge that looks like a piece of meat around.
- Why: Bacterial infection and pus accumulation.
- Dental Cyst
- Description: Cysts that occur in the environment or in the tooth root, meat-like structure that may form.
- Why: Cysts that occur in the tooth root or abnormal tissues.
- Tooth Extraction Poorly Healed Wound
- Description: A piece of meat in infected wounds or heal after tooth extraction may occur.
- Why: Complications after tooth extraction.
- Gingival Hyperplasia
- Description: Excessive growth of the gums or swelling.
- Why: Excessive brushing, certain medications, or genetic factors.
- Erupsi Granuloma
- Description: In the process of the teeth like structures out of meat.
- Why: Out of the teeth occurring in the process of inflammation.
Symptoms
- Swelling: Molar pronounced in the vicinity of the swelling.
- Pain: Discomfort or pain associated with swelling and a piece of meat.
- Bleeding: Bleeding from a piece of meat or tenderness.
- Smelly Discharge: The perimeter of a piece of meat from smelly fluid or discharge.
